Everyday Apps That Shine

Navigation is the star. Apple Maps, Google Maps, and Waze all do a great job on car screens, with big, glanceable guidance and timely rerouting. You can share ETA with contacts, switch between fastest and toll‑free options, and see lane guidance and speed limit info in many areas. If you’re in an EV, apps that expose charging stations and live availability are a game changer; Apple Maps and Google Maps have improved here, and specialized apps continue to get better.

Pro Tips, Shortcuts, and Hidden Gems

Go voice‑first. Use the steering wheel voice button and natural phrases: “Get directions to 221B Baker Street,” “Call Jamie on speaker,” “Text Sam I’m five minutes out,” “Play my Focus playlist,” or “Find the nearest coffee with good reviews.” You’ll spend less time hunting the screen and more time watching the road. On iPhone, “Announce Messages” can read incoming texts automatically—great for solo drives. If your car supports it, glance at the instrument cluster for turn prompts so you’re not flicking your eyes to the center screen.

Negotiation Without Drama

Contact sellers with a short, clear message: confirm availability, ask for the VIN, service history, and the written OTD (for dealers) or your DMV estimate (for private sellers). State you’re pre-approved (if true) and can visit today or tomorrow. Set the tone as friendly, decisive, and time-efficient. For price talks, anchor slightly below your target to leave room to meet in the middle; always bring the conversation back to OTD. If a dealer won’t quote OTD, that’s a red flag—hidden fees often live there. For private sales, ask about last service, tires’ age, brakes, and any pending lights. Signals of care often justify a small premium.

Inspect Before You Celebrate

The cheapest car near you is only a deal if it’s mechanically sound. Inspect in daylight on a dry surface. Start cold: listen for misfires, ticks, or belt squeal. Look for paint mismatch, panel gaps, and overspray that suggest prior damage. Check tire wear patterns and date codes, rotors for grooves, and fluid colors (black oil or metallic glitter is a no). Scan with a simple OBD tool to catch pending codes. Run the HVAC through all modes, windows and locks on all doors, and test every light. On the test drive, take a mix of city and highway, check straight-line tracking, and feel for vibration under braking.

Authentication: Get Comfortable With Proof

While no single check is foolproof, stacking verification steps dramatically lowers your risk. First, request proof-of-purchase if available: original receipts (with sensitive info masked), boutique stamps, and service records. Ask for close-ups of brand-specific markers—font engraving, stitching patterns, glazing, hardware finish, lining texture, heat stamps, and serial/date codes. Learn the basics for your target brand; for example, how to read a Louis Vuitton date code, how Chanel series numbers align with production years, or the look of Hermès blind stamps. Authentic items also tend to show wear in ways that make sense: softening of leather in high-touch spots, micro-scratches on hardware, even patina on untreated leathers.

Tracking Basics: How It Works (and What Each Status Means)

Your Car28 tracking link follows the package through the carrier’s network. Early on, you might see “Order confirmed” or “Preparing for shipment” while the warehouse packs your items. “Label created” means the paperwork is ready; real movement starts when the first facility scans the box. From there, expect a series of hops: “Departed facility,” “Arrived at facility,” and sometimes the city or hub names. “In transit” is a catch-all for the travel in between scans. Near the end, you will see “Out for delivery,” which usually precedes arrival by hours, and “Delivered” once a final scan happens. If you see “Exception,” “Delay,” or “Delivery attempted,” it means the carrier hit a snag (weather, closed gate, incorrect address, or a missed handoff). Note that scans are not continuous; gaps of 12–48 hours can be normal, especially between hubs or over weekends. ETAs update as the carrier gets new data, so it is common to see the delivery date nudge forward or back a day as the route unfolds.
